Trillium Health Partners (THP) is one of the largest community-based acute care facilities in Canada. Comprised of the Credit Valley Hospital, the Mississauga Hospital and the Queensway Health Centre, Trillium HealthPartners serves the growing and diverse populations of Mississauga, West Toronto and surrounding communities and is a teaching hospital affiliated with the University of Toronto.

Overview of the opportunity:

Reporting to the President and CEO, the Executive Coordinator: prepares strategic reports, communications and presentations, manages and coordinates key functions in the CEO Office to support executive decision making, manages operations of senior leadership meetings and all related functions to ensure its effectiveness, and acts as liaison with internal and external stakeholders.

Managing Information Flow & Ensure Strategic Decision Making

Liaison with internal stakeholders on behalf of CEO to provide direction and guidance on requests, communicate ideas and perform follow-up to ensure completion, escalating risks as appropriate.

Managing Senior Leadership Decision Making

Developing senior leadership committee work plans, agendas and follow-up; and
Project managing development of senior team retreats and coordinating preparation with cross-functional team.

Preparing Communications, Briefings, Presentations & Reports

Performing external and internal research and analysis across a broad spectrum of specialties, to createreports, presentations, speeches, speaking notes, letters and other documents for both internal andexternal use, collaborating with hospital departments and external stakeholders as necessary; and,
Managing communications from staff, physicians, board members, and other internal/externalstakeholders by responding to requests, questions and concerns, gathering additional information,triaging and referring to key leadership to ensure requests are addressed in a strategic, timely andcoordinated manner.

Supporting Effective CEO Office Operations

Managing issues and projects directly related to the CEO office;
Working with the Board Office to ensure alignment of Board and CEO priorities; and
Working with Executive Assistant to President and CEO to support the day to day efficient functioning ofthe office, including managing urgent priorities and answering and redirecting questions from internaland external stakeholders
